    Huzzah Creek (locally / ˈ h uː z ɑː /) is a 35.8-mile-long (57.6 km) [3] clear-flowing stream in the southern part of the U.S. state of Missouri. [4] According to the information in the Ramsay Place Names File at the University of Missouri, the creek's name "is evidently derived from" Huzzaus, one of the early French versions of the name of the Osage people.

    Garrison is an unincorporated community in southeast Christian County, Missouri, United States. [1] It is located on Route 125, approximately 15 miles southeast of Sparta. Garrison is part of the Springfield, Missouri Metropolitan Statistical Area. A post office called Garrison was established in 1884, and remained in operation until 1995. [2]
